WebThe reduction is calculated as follows: For families with one child eligible for the benefit, the reduction is 3.2% of the amount of adjusted family net income greater than $71,060. For families with two or more children eligible for the benefit, the reduction is 5.7% of the amount of adjusted family net income greater than $71,060. WebJan 30, 2024 · First we'll look at deductions. A tax deduction reduces your taxable income, so the more deductions you have, the less income you'll have to be taxed, and the less tax you'll have to pay. The amount a deduction will save depends on your top tax rate. For example, if you're in the 12% tax bracket, a $100 deduction will save you $12 in income tax.
